WitrynaDescribe the respiratory chain (electron transport chain) and its role in cellular respiration; ... and oxygen is reduced to form water. The electron transport chain (Figure 1) is the last component of aerobic respiration and is the only part of glucose metabolism that uses atmospheric oxygen. WitrynaAdvantages of Anaerobic Respiration. One advantage of anaerobic respiration is obvious. It lets organisms live in places where there is little or no oxygen. Such places include deep water, soil, and the digestive tracts of animals such as humans (see Figure below). WitrynaAbstract. Although water is an end-product and not a primary reactant of the overall respiration process, it is essential that a cell should have an adequate water content for respiration to proceed.
